Location: Saltdean, South Downs, England
The Around Swanborough Hill Run provides an exhilarating journey through the picturesque landscapes of Saltdean, spanning just over 13km. Beginning at the end of Longridge Avenue, the route opens with a gentle ascent, making it accessible for runners keen to acclimatise and soak in the serene beauty of their surroundings. The initial 4km are relatively easy, perfect for establishing a steady rhythm as you traverse charming trails.
As you advance, the challenge increases and the path steepens, leading you to the summit of Swanborough Hill, where you are rewarded with breathtaking panoramic views encompassing the South Downs and beyond. The terrain varies from grassy tracks to rocky sections, offering mild challenges that enhance the thrill of the run. It's a rewarding experience for those who embrace the elevation.
Upon reaching the summit, you’ll descend into the idyllic Cricketing Bottom valley, where the tranquility amplifies the charm of your journey. A short climb takes you to the quaint village of Telescombe, perfectly nestled within the hills. The finale of your run features a downhill stretch back to Saltdean, inviting a fast finish while revealing glimpses of the stunning coastline as you near your destination.
